Alabama Tin Shop LLC is a Sheet Metal Contractor offering Metal Sheering, Sheet Metal, Fabrication and Tin Shop services for the area of Birmingham AL since 1960.
Sheet Metal Contractor, Tin Shop, Metal Sheering, Fabrication, Sheet Metal, Birmingham AL.
more